Sara Garcia & Olmo Cuna
Sara García & Olmo Cuña work in an interdisciplinary field that combines performance, food, audiovisual media, and craft techniques to explore how we relate to the unknown and our environment. They investigate what we cannot master, control, or name. Within the broad concept of the unknown, they are particularly interested in the idea of hospitality with the Other, as well as in exploring techniques that enable us to ‘stretch and contract time’ through the moving image.
They both studied Fine Arts at the University of Vigo and completed a master’s in Artistic Production at the Polytechnic University of Valencia, later joining the SOMA Educational Program in Mexico City (2016). Their work has been shown at institutions like LABoral (Asturias), XIV FEMSA Biennial (Mexico), CCESantiago (Chile), and Can Felipa (Barcelona), and featured in screenings at Cineteca Matadero (Madrid). They have collaborated with various art centres like Fundación Cerezales Antonino y Cinia (León) and participated in residency programs such as MGLC (Ljubljana), MeetFactory (Prague), and the Spanish Academy in Rome.
